Ukraine removes U.S. Abrams tanks due to Russian drone threats

Ukraine has made the decision to sideline the U.S.-provided Abrams M1A1 battle tanks in their fight against Russia due to the increasing threat posed by Russian drone warfare. According to two U.S. military officials, the advanced capabilities of Russian drones have made it too difficult for the tanks to operate without being detected or coming under attack. This decision highlights the evolving nature of modern warfare, where drones are playing an increasingly important role in military operations.

The Abrams M1A1 battle tanks were provided to Ukraine by the United States as part of efforts to support the country in its conflict with Russia. However, the tanks have now been deemed less effective in the face of the threat posed by Russian drones. These drones are equipped with advanced surveillance and targeting capabilities, allowing them to detect and target tanks with precision. As a result, the tanks have been sidelined in order to avoid being vulnerable to these attacks.
